Decision
Planning Permission on 24th August 1998
Conditions / Refusal Reasons
That the development must be begun not later than the expiration of five
years beginning with the date of this permission and if this condition
is not complied with this permission shall lapse.
Reason: By virtue of Sections 91 to 95 of the Town and Country Planning
Act 1990.
That the materials to be used for the roofs shall of the same colour,
type and texture as those used on the existing building.
Reason: To ensure that the details of the development are satisfactory.
That samples of the materials to be used for the frontage wall shall be
subm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ority
before any development commences.
Reason: To ensure that the details of the development are satisfactory.
That the parking provision shall be as shown on the deposited drawing,
reference 98031 Rev. C all constructed, surfaced and laid out, retained
and maintained to the satisfaction of the Local Planning Authority.
Reason: To comply with the Local Planning Authority's vehicle parking
standards and to protect local amenities.
That the windows shall be provided only in accordance with the details
shown on drawing 98031 Rev.C and shall thereafter be retained in
accordance with the approved details.
Reason: To ensure that the development is not unneighbourly.
That notwithstanding the provisions of Article 3 of, and Class A of Part 1
of Schedule 2 to the Town and Country Planning (General Permitted
Development) Order 1995 (or any order revoking or re-enacting that Order),
no additional windows shall be inserted unless planning permission
has first been granted by the Local Planning Authority on a formal
application in respect thereof.
Reason: To protect local amenities.
